What the F/02 error code actually means

The washer tried to pump out the water but it took too long, so the machine stopped and showed this error to protect itself. This usually means something is blocking the water from draining, like a kinked hose or a clogged filter. Until the blockage is cleared, the washer will not complete its cycle.

Most common causes of F/02

Ranked by how often they cause this code
  1. 1Kinked or blocked drain hose
  2. 2Clogged pump filter or coin trap
  3. 3Foreign object in the pump impeller
  4. 4Failed or weak drain pump motor
  5. 5Improper drain hose installation

Questions people ask about F/02

What does F/02 mean on a Maytag washer?
F/02 means the washer detected a long drain condition, where the tub took more than eight minutes to drain. When this happens, the control board shuts off the water valves and stops the cycle. The code points to a restriction or failure in the drain system that is preventing the pump from evacuating water at a normal rate.
Is it safe to use my washer when it shows F/02?
You should not continue running wash cycles while the F/02 code is active. The control board has already shut off the water valves, and the tub may still contain standing water that has not fully drained. Running the machine in this state can stress the pump motor and potentially lead to water remaining in the drum, which creates odor and mold issues over time.
How much does it cost to repair an F/02 error on a Maytag washer?
If the fix is simply clearing a kinked hose or cleaning a clogged filter, the repair costs nothing beyond your time. If the drain pump motor needs to be replaced, parts typically run in the range of $25 to $80 depending on the model, with professional labor adding another $100 to $200 in most markets. Diagnosing and resolving a blockage in the pump impeller is usually on the lower end of that cost range if a technician is involved.
How do I fix an F/02 error on my Maytag washer?
Start by checking the drain hose for kinks or blockages and confirm it is routed and installed correctly. Next, clean the pump filter if your model has an accessible one, as built-up lint and debris are a common culprit. If the hose and filter are clear, inspect the pump impeller for trapped objects and test the pump motor for proper function. Replacing a faulty pump motor will resolve the code if mechanical blockages are not the cause.
Will resetting the washer clear the F/02 code?
A reset may clear the code temporarily and allow a cycle to start, but if the underlying drain restriction or pump problem is not corrected, the code will return within the same or next cycle once the drain time limit is exceeded again. Address the root cause first, then reset the machine to confirm the fault does not reappear.
